City of Kingman Announces Full Closure of Kino Avenue and Benton Street for Utility Installation (thebee.news) — If you drive Kino Avenue or Benton Street, expect full closures this Thursday, May 14, from 6 a.m. to 6 p.m. in Kingman for utility installation work. Traffic will be detoured to Gordon Drive, so plan extra time and watch for posted signs or check the KingmanAZConnect app for updates.

City of Kingman Warns Residents Of Fraudulent Emails Impersonating City Departments (thebee.news) — Kingman residents involved in permits, rezonings, or development projects are being targeted by sophisticated phishing emails that impersonate City of Kingman departments and staff. City officials urge you to double-check sender addresses, avoid clicking suspicious links, and verify any payment requests directly through official city contacts or the SmartGov portal before sending money or personal information.

Master Gardener Program cultivates skills — and community — in Kingman (thestandardnewspaper.online) — Kingman residents curious about gardening in our tough desert climate can tap into the University of Arizona Cooperative Extension’s Master Gardener Program at Beale and First Streets. Volunteers answer gardening questions by phone or site visit, lead workshops at Kingman Community Gardens, and share research-based tips at local events like the Home & Garden Show and Tomato Quest.

Local students celebrated in Utah Tech University's 115th commencement (thestandardnewspaper.online) — Two Kingman residents, Jacob Hughes and Jackson Cronk, are among the local students honored in Utah Tech University’s 2025 graduating class of 3,078. The diverse group spans 21 countries and 43 states, with many first-generation and nontraditional students, showcasing regional academic achievement that includes several Mohave County communities.
